Output 43186c820833bfe55d108001e64ceeb89169dde0078b0fa2da31f5fdfade7775:4

value
1068034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8d31d879cefe6eec548f1b021eb4aaa84e31d40 OP_EQUAL
address
3QNgQfn9fadhzazojk5AEoWBmdhj1sUVXF
transaction
43186c820833bfe55d108001e64ceeb89169dde0078b0fa2da31f5fdfade7775
spent
true